What is a Private Psychiatrist?
A private psychiatrist is a medically trained doctor who concentrates on the diagnosis, treatment, and management of mental health disorders. They provide skilled suggestions and personalized treatments in their private practice, frequently offering quicker access to care compared to the NHS.

Cost can be a considerable aspect when considering private psychiatric services. The costs for a private psychiatrist can vary based on experience, area, and kind of visit. Below is a normal breakdown:

Q2: Will my insurance coverage cover private psychiatric services?
Many private health insurance prepares cover psychiatry, however it's important to validate the specifics with your insurance coverage company. Pre-authorization may be required.
Q3: Is private psychiatric care much better than NHS care?
Each has its strengths and weaknesses. Private psychiatry provides quicker access and tailored services, while NHS care is usually more budget friendly and accessible to all.

Q5: Can private psychiatrists recommend medications?
Yes, private psychiatrists have the authority to recommend medications as part of an extensive treatment plan.
